Municipality of the Pāvilosta rural territory is the municipality institution that was developed on July 1, 2009. Merging rural territory of
Saka (that was comprised of the rural municipality of Saka and town
of Pāvilosta) and rural municipality of Vērgale the rural territory of
Pāvilosta was created. Administrative centre of the rural territory of
Pāvilosta is the town of Pāvilosta. Pāvilosta rural territory takes up
515 km2, but the border of the Baltic Sea with the rural territory of
Pāvilosta is 46 km. Number of inhabitants (declared persons) onto
25.08.2014 is 3004 persons.

Rural territory of Pāvilosta is rich in culturally historical and natural
heritage but it has not been sufficiently explored and promoted yet. Due
to the implementation of the project the following tourism signs were
created: 1. Tourism direction sign – signpost – big – 2 pieces. 2. Tourism
direction sign – sign post – small - 24 pieces. 3. Informative stand
with anti-graffiti covering - vertically (841mm x 1189 mm) 7 pieces. 4.
Informative stand with anti-graffiti covering - vertically (1189mm x
1642 mm) 10 pieces. 5. Informative maps stand with anti-graffiti covering (1189mm x 1642 mm) 5 pieces. Information about the nature and
cultural objects were placed in every populated area in the rural territory
of Pāvilosta where the nature and culturally historical objects are
located: in Pāvilosta, Saraiķi, Vērgale and Ziemupe. Also five big stands
with the general tourism information of the Pāvilosta rural territory were
developed and placed. Side notes planned in the project was placed on
the municipality land, as well as with the approval of the Latvian State
roads, Tourims Development State Agency and other institutions.
